The Albumin-to-Creatinine Ratio (Alb/Creat Ratio) is a crucial diagnostic tool used to assess kidney health. It measures the amount of albumin, a type of protein, in the urine relative to creatinine, a waste product from muscle activity. The ratio provides valuable insights into kidney function and helps identify potential kidney damage or disease. What is the Albumin-to-Creatinine Ratio (Alb/Creat Ratio)?
The Alb/Creat Ratio is a calculated value obtained by dividing the amount of albumin in the urine by the amount of creatinine. Albumin is a protein produced by the liver and excreted into the bloodstream. Under normal conditions, the kidneys filter waste and excess fluids from the blood while retaining essential proteins like albumin. However, when the kidneys are damaged or diseased, they may allow albumin to pass into the urine, a condition known as albuminuria.
Creatinine, on the other hand, is a waste product generated by muscle activity and excreted by the kidneys. The amount of creatinine in the urine is directly related to muscle mass and kidney function. By comparing the levels of albumin and creatinine in the urine, the Alb/Creat Ratio provides a sensitive indicator of kidney damage or disease.
Interpreting the Alb/Creat Ratio
The Alb/Creat Ratio is typically expressed in milligrams per gram (mg/g) or micrograms per milligram (μg/mg). The ratio can be interpreted as follows:
| Alb/Creat Ratio (mg/g) | Interpretation |
|---|---|
| < 30 | Normal |
| 30-300 | Microalbuminuria (early kidney damage) |
| > 300 | Macroalbuminuria (overt kidney damage) |
A ratio of less than 30 mg/g is considered normal. A ratio between 30-300 mg/g indicates microalbuminuria, which is a sign of early kidney damage. A ratio greater than 300 mg/g indicates macroalbuminuria, which is a sign of overt kidney damage.
Clinical Significance of the Alb/Creat Ratio
The Alb/Creat Ratio has significant clinical implications in the diagnosis and management of kidney disease. It is widely used in clinical practice to:
- Screen for kidney disease in high-risk patients (e.g., those with diabetes, hypertension, or a family history of kidney disease)
- Monitor kidney function in patients with established kidney disease
- Assess the effectiveness of treatment and make informed decisions about disease management
The Alb/Creat Ratio is also a strong predictor of cardiovascular disease and mortality. Studies have shown that albuminuria is associated with an increased risk of cardiovascular events, including heart attacks, strokes, and cardiovascular-related deaths.
Limitations and Considerations
While the Alb/Creat Ratio is a valuable diagnostic tool, it has some limitations and considerations. For example:
The ratio may be influenced by factors such as muscle mass, hydration status, and certain medications. Additionally, the test may not be suitable for all patients, such as those with a history of kidney transplantation or those with significant proteinuria.
